About Jia-Yong Lao

Jia-Yong Lao is a scholar working on Health, Toxicology and Mutagenesis, Pollution and Environmental Chemistry, having authored 24 papers that have together received 598 indexed citations. Recurring topics across this work include Toxic Organic Pollutants Impact (14 papers), Air Quality and Health Impacts (8 papers) and Pharmaceutical and Antibiotic Environmental Impacts (5 papers). The work is most often cited by research in Health, Toxicology and Mutagenesis (396 citations), Pollution (202 citations) and Environmental Chemistry (76 citations). Jia-Yong Lao has collaborated with scholars based in China, Hong Kong and Macao. Frequent co-authors include Paul K.S. Lam, Eddy Y. Zeng, Yuefei Ruan, Kmy Leung, Lian‐Jun Bao, Chen-Chou Wu, Huiju Lin, Rongben Wu, Shu Tao and Kai Zhang. Their work appears in journals such as Environmental Science & Technology, The Science of The Total Environment and Water Research.
